颈椎后路单开门椎管成形术治疗多节段脊髓型颈椎病38例分析  被引量:11

Treatment of multi-segmental cervical spondylotic myelopathy with posterior cervical single-door laminoplasty:a report of 38 cases

摘  要:目的评价颈椎后路单开门椎管成形术结合微型钛板治疗多节段脊髓型颈椎病(cervical spondylotic myelopathy,CSM)的临床疗效,分析手术并发症的原因。方法采用颈椎后路单开门椎管扩大成形结合微型钛板治疗多节段CSM 38例,均采用颈椎后路C_3~C_7单开门椎管扩大成形术,记录手术时间、术中出血量、术后引流量,比较术前、术后日本骨科学会评分(JOA)评分、颈椎曲度、视觉模拟评分(VAS)评分,随访术后神经功能改善情况,颈椎活动度并分析术后并发症。结果 JOA评分[术前(7.1±0.9)比术后(3.6±1.2)]及VAS评分[术前(5.2±2.8)比术后(2.3±1.1)]较术前改善明显,所有患者术后神经功能与术前比较均明显改善,差异有统计学意义(P<0.05);颈椎活动度无明显变化[术前(36.9±6.3)度比术后(32.7±2.4)度,P>0.05];术后发生脑脊液漏1例,术后第5天改善,发生C,神经根麻痹1例,于术后2个月改善,未发生脊髓损伤、钛板断裂、伤口感染等并发症。结论颈椎后路单开门椎管扩大成形术结合微型钛板是治疗CSM的一种可靠的方法,可以持续维持扩大椎管的管径,取得较好的远期临床疗效,并且有利于维持颈椎生理曲度。Objective To investigate the clinical effects of cervical single-door with micro titani-um plate on multiple segmental cervical spondylotic myelopathy(CSM).Methods The clinical results of 38 cases of CSMpatients in treatment of single-door with micro titanium plate were studied.The operation time,blood loss,postoperative drainage,cervical curvature,surgical complications,neurological function, the change of range of motion and scores of JOA and VAS were compared.Results The neurological function recovery,scores of JOA and VAS compared with preoperative were obvious,the difference was sta-tistically significant(P 〈0.05).There was no significant difference in range of motion[(36.9 ±6.3)°vs (32.7 ±2.4)°,P 〉0.05].There was one case of postoperative cerebrospinal fluid leakage,on the first postoperative 5 days the symptom was improved;there was one case of C5 nerve root palsy,after two months the symptom was improved.Conclusion Cervical single door laminoplasty will be a effective op-eration for treatment of patients with CMS.

关 键 词:脊髓型颈椎病 椎管扩大成形术 微型钛板固定
